Abir — Islamic Name Meaning
Abir
عبير
👩 Girl's Name
Arabic Origin
Perfume, aroma, fragrant

Frequently Asked Questions
What does Abir mean in Islam?
Abir (عبير) means "Perfume, aroma, fragrant" in Arabic. It is a girl's name of Arabic origin.
Is Abir a Quranic name?
Abir is not directly mentioned in the Quran, but it is a well-established Islamic name with a beautiful meaning rooted in Arabic language and Islamic culture.
How do you write Abir in Arabic?
Abir is written as عبير in Arabic script. In Turkish it is written as Abir, and in Urdu as عبیر.
What are variants of the name Abir?
Common variants and alternative spellings of Abir include: Abeer.
Is Abir a popular name?
Yes, Abir is popular in Morocco, Algeria, Egypt, Saudi Arabia, Lebanon and many other Muslim communities worldwide.
